What? You have 10 full boxes of paper goods? Should you preserve every last scrap of paper in those boxes? Is that possible?
Possible? Sure, I guess so...but it's not very practical for the average collector. It may be cost prohibitive to preserve everything! So, where do you draw the line? That's where you need to make some solid decisions. Ask yourself some questions before tossing away anything.
Is it valuable?
Determine how valuable each piece is. Ask for some expert advice if you need help with this.
Perhaps, you may need to consult with an antique appraiser, for some of your more valuable paper items.
Is it historical?
If your piece of paper ephemera has some historical importance, consider loaning or donating it to a museum or public library. Let them preserve and display it for you!

If you are looking for some scrapbook ideas for your scrapbook pages, then why not "safely" preserve some of those memories in a scrapbook?
Make sure to protect that special paper ephemera properly by using acid-free, archival quality products. Use cotton gloves when handing old paper pieces to prevent further damage from the oil in your hands.
